First things first—what makes HDPE (High-Density Polyethylene) the go-to material for medical and pharmaceutical packaging? Let's break it down. HDPE is a thermoplastic polymer known for its exceptional strength, chemical resistance, and versatility. Unlike some other plastics, it's inert, meaning it won't react with the contents inside—critical when you're dealing with medications that need to maintain their potency and purity over time.
Think about the medications you take regularly. Whether it's a bottle of pain relievers, a supply of vitamins, or prescription pills, the last thing you want is for the packaging to interact with the product. HDPE's resistance to oils, alcohols, and many solvents ensures that even sensitive formulations stay stable. Plus, it's lightweight yet durable, making it ideal for both storage and transportation—no more worrying about bottles cracking during shipping or losing their shape on pharmacy shelves.
Another key advantage? HDPE is naturally opaque, which helps protect light-sensitive medications from UV rays that could degrade their effectiveness. While some plastics require added colorants to achieve this, HDPE's inherent properties mean less processing and a more cost-effective solution for bulk orders. And for products that don't need light protection? Clear variants are also available, offering flexibility for brands that want to showcase their formulations.

When it comes to pharmaceutical packaging, "close enough" just isn't good enough. That's where certifications like ISO 9001:2015 and G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) come into play. These aren't just fancy labels—they're guarantees that the manufacturing process meets strict quality and safety standards, ensuring that every bottle that leaves the factory is consistent, reliable, and safe for use.
An ISO 9001 certified packaging factory operates under a quality management system that's audited regularly. This means everything from raw material sourcing to production line processes is documented, monitored, and continuously improved. For you, this translates to peace of mind—knowing that your packaging is made to the same high standards every single time, reducing the risk of defects or inconsistencies.
Then there's GMP compliance, which is especially critical for pharmaceutical products. A dust-free GMP compliant workshop is designed to minimize contamination risks. Imagine a facility where air quality is controlled, employees wear protective gear, and surfaces are regularly sanitized—all to ensure that no foreign particles or microbes make their way into the bottles. This level of precision is non-negotiable when packaging products that will be ingested or used in medical settings.
Together, these certifications set apart true medical-grade suppliers from those cutting corners. When you choose a supplier with both ISO 9001 and GMP credentials, you're not just buying bottles—you're investing in a partnership that prioritizes safety and quality as much as you do.
Not all 8oz HDPE bottles are created equal. The best suppliers offer a range of features and customization options to meet your specific needs. Let's take a look at what sets a premium bottle apart:
The seal is the first line of defense against moisture, air, and contaminants. Look for bottles with tight-fitting caps, such as child-resistant closures (CRCs) for medications that need extra safety measures, or tamper-evident seals to assure consumers that the product hasn't been opened before purchase. Some suppliers even offer induction sealing options, which create an airtight barrier when the cap is applied—perfect for extending shelf life.

To ensure you're getting the right bottle for your product, it's important to understand the technical specs. Here's a quick overview of what to consider, laid out in a simple table:
| Feature | Details |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Material | Medical-grade HDPE, FDA-compliant | Ensures safety and compatibility with pharmaceutical products |
| Capacity | 8oz (240ml), with tolerances of ±2% | Consistent volume for accurate filling and dosage |
| Wall Thickness | 0.8mm–1.2mm (varies by design) | Balances durability and weight for cost-effective shipping |
| Closure Size | 28/410, 38/400 (standard neck finishes) | Compatibility with standard caps and dispensers |
| Certifications | ISO 9001:2015, GMP, FDA 21 CFR Part 177 | Compliance with global regulatory standards |

When choosing a supplier for your 8oz HDPE pharmaceutical bottles, it's easy to focus solely on the product. But the best partnerships go beyond just delivering bottles—they offer a full suite of services to simplify your packaging process. Here are some key offerings to look for:
From raw material inspection to final packaging, a reputable supplier will have rigorous quality control checks at every stage. This might include testing for dimensional accuracy, verifying seal integrity, and conducting chemical compatibility tests to ensure the bottles work with your specific product. Ask about their quality management system—ideally, they'll have documentation and certifications to back up their claims, giving you confidence in every shipment.
The pharmaceutical industry is heavily regulated, and navigating compliance can be a headache. A supplier with experience in medical-grade packaging will understand the ins and outs of global regulations, from FDA requirements in the U.S. to EU standards in Europe. They should be able to provide documentation like material safety data sheets (MSDS), certificates of analysis (COA), and compliance statements to help you meet your own regulatory obligations.
As consumers become more eco-conscious, sustainable packaging is no longer a nice-to-have—it's a necessity. Look for suppliers that offer options like PCR (Post-Consumer Recycled) HDPE, which reduces reliance on virgin plastic and lowers environmental impact. Some even provide recycling programs or guidance on designing for recyclability, helping your brand meet its sustainability goals while maintaining packaging performance.
